About

A mattermost client for conveniently encrypting messages using GnuPG via GPGME.

Setup

Install from source: cargo install mgpg

When running mgpg for the first time you'll be guided through a setup process. Your Mattermost password will be securely stored in your "keyring". Other configuration values are stored in "~./config/mgpg" in plain format.

To rerun the setup process, replacing all previous values, run mgpg --reinit.

Usage

Make sure GPG is aware of the recipient's public key by importing the key. You can verify that the public key has been imported via gpg --fingerprint recipient@mail.com or alternatively, check the output of gpg --list-keys.

Encrypt message using the public key of the recipient and send it as a direct message to the recipient: echo "In God we trust. The rest we monitor." | mgpg --to edward.lyle@mail.com

In addition to encrypting messages you may also sign them, before sending them: echo "It's a brave new world out there." | mgpg --sign --to robert.dean@mail.com

Pass message as parameter: mgpg --sign --to edward.lyle@mail.com -- "In God we trust. The rest we monitor."
